Automate PII Redaction with Amazon Bedrock

Detect and redact personally identifiable information using Amazon Bedrock Data Automation and Guardrails

Organizations are increasingly tasked with protecting Personally Identifiable Information (PII) such as social security numbers and phone numbers due to data privacy regulations and customer trust concerns. Manual PII redaction is inefficient and error-prone, especially as data volumes grow. Amazon Bedrock Data Automation and Guardrails offer a solution by automating PII detection and redaction across various content types, including emails and attachments. This approach ensures consistent protection, operational efficiency, scalability, and compliance, while providing a user interface for managing redacted communications securely. The solution provides a complete email processing workflow, featuring a React-based user interface for authorized personnel to manage and review redacted communications securely. This includes automated email categorization and customizable folder management, which streamline communication workflows. By using Amazon Bedrock Data Automation to extract text from documents and Bedrock Guardrails to detect and redact PII, the system ensures that all sensitive information is handled consistently and securely. The integration with AWS services like Lambda, EventBridge, and DynamoDB further enhances the system’s capabilities, providing a robust framework for managing sensitive data.
